Syd Lexia wrote:
Nintendo has turned a profit on all Wii hardware sales since launch. I don't know what their numbers are now, but Sony and MS were losing money on each console sale at launch.

I did a bit of searching and it seems as though most sites are reporting the same figures: Wii units cost about $150-$160 to produce.

I am seeing widely varying results for PS3 & 360s.

It seems as though the PS3's are closer to a wash because Sony is able to use their own chip making facilities to produce many of the parts they would otherwise need to buy or build factories for. It is also worth noting that a PS3 helps Sony with both game sales as well as Blu-Ray movie sales.

Everything I read says that Microsoft takes a huge loss on each console. I have seen loss numbers ranging from $150-$300 per unit.

IGN wrote:
"We believe there's still more we can do with the Wii," Iwata said when an analyst asked him about the release of a Wii successor. On the possibility of Nintendo limiting its Wii resources in favor of development for a new console, he said, "We are in no way thinking 'the Wii is near the end of its platform cycle so we will limit our investments.'"

I really hope Iwata is flatout lying. Nintendo was reportedly very upset that news of the 3DS leaked before E3. They begrudingly admitted existed as rumor control.

Really, there doesn't seem to be much Nintendo can still do with the Wii in terms of new games. The A-list titles (Mario, Zelda, Metroid) have been trotted out not once, but twice, already as have the popular casual titles Wii Sports and Wii Fit. I mean, where else is there to go? Wii Play 2? The first one was, at best, okay, and its sales numbers hinged entirely on the fact that it came with a second controller. Wii Music 2? The first one was a critical and commercial failure. Another Animal Crossing? Fucking kill me. StarFox, Kirby, and F-Zero? A little late to be bringing out the secondary titles, isn't it?

GameStop employees have reported that Zelda Wii is showing up with a November release in their computer system, and that date seems legitimate to me. It also sounds like the last A-list title the Wii will get. If Nintendo doesn't have another console in the works, they are in serious trouble.

Doddsino wrote:
It seems they just gave up on Kirby after the awfulness that was Kirby 64.

Kirby still gets games. Canvas Curse was the first DS title I ever bought, and I still rank it as one of the best. The thing about Kirby is that he was originally conceived as a Gameboy character. I think Nintendo has moved him back towards that.

The classic Pokemon RPGs, the way they're designed, are much more desirable and marketable as portable titles as well. Trading is supposed to be a large part of the game, and that's much easier to accomplish on the portable systems than it is on consoles. On could argue that it SHOULD be just as easy on the Wii, but unfortunately it's not.
